Output d1d95da1e5eeaffdee7eac31d2c752c3fc6b7f6072c4ee33d6041daf945c8d8a:1

value
1010522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309011d59ede471dadffa7ef64b9741349892755 OP_EQUAL
address
367nwtRkqmDW3Q7aPEHwURdjiHKpvJtS3d
transaction
d1d95da1e5eeaffdee7eac31d2c752c3fc6b7f6072c4ee33d6041daf945c8d8a
confirmations
202449
spent
true